We had a great time today:
• Sara Beth Abernathy our 2018 champion YoungTales storyteller told her winning story about a kamikaze bird.
John Paul Schulz told a great reminiscence about a wardrobe malfunction turned red badge that became a fad.
Mary Elena Rivera Kirk regaled us with one of her wonderful native stories from Puerto Rico.
Delmas Franklin gave a uplifting account of a very determined woman who ministered to orphans in Chattanooga, and someone in 2018 who owes much to that "angel".
• Bob (Beverly M. Harris) Harris told about the way stories helped him through the pain of childhood treatents for hemophilia and told one about Winnie and Eyore.
